Searchcode
Searchcode is a free, web-based code search engine that indexes public source code from repositories like GitHub, GitLab, and Bitbucket. It allows developers to quickly find code snippets, libraries, and examples across multiple programming languages and projects. The tool provides advanced search capabilities, including filtering by language, repository, and license, to help locate relevant code efficiently.
Developers should use Searchcode when they need to discover how to implement specific functionality, find open-source libraries, or learn from real-world code examples. It is particularly useful for debugging, learning new technologies, or researching best practices by examining code from established projects. This tool saves time compared to manual searching and helps in understanding code patterns across different contexts.